Handover for the Millrace build farm — welcome aboard. The core issue you're inheriting is clock skew between agents in the Ostbury and Fenwick racks. Artifact timestamps drive cache invalidation, so even a two-second drift causes spurious full rebuilds and occasionally a signed artifact with a timestamp in the future, which the verifier rejects. We've deployed a sync sidecar on every agent that disciplines the local clock against the farm coordinator. Do not adjust agents manually. The sidecar's runtime settings are listed below.

deployment values, kafof-yagap:
[druwyn]
host = druwyn.nelvrolabs.internal
user = druwyn_svc
database = druwyn_prod

## Deployment

Quibble-Bot posts deploy status to the Mantleworks internal chat. It runs as a single stateless container behind the Ferncastle gateway. No inbound ports are exposed; it polls the deploy ledger over mTLS. Secrets are injected at start via the Ostrander vault sidecar and never written to disk. Review the token scopes before approving promotion to production — the bot needs read-only ledger access only. The container starts with the following configuration values.

settings of faweg-bahop:
[wenvan]
port = 5000
team = belax
host = wenvan.qorvelsys.test
region = east-1
access_code = ac_020232
timeout_ms = 1500

Time to put the Grimsby ORM layer out of its misery. The legacy mapper in Pondworks still hand-builds SQL strings and silently swallows type errors. Plan: wrap it behind a repository interface, migrate one model at a time, delete the old thing by Q3. Future folks: the proof-of-concept branch build is identified by the token below.

build token for kagaf-hahof: htk14_9d3d4d26d7d8de